Resources See Also Further Reading Information about overwithholding in: ... WebThe title of this “process unit” (as referred to by the IRS) is: Adjustments for overwithholding on Form 1042 . In general, this process unit discusses adjustments for overwithholding of tax on payments of U.S.-source income to foreign persons on Forms 1042 tax returns and Forms 1042-S information returns.
